UP govt. official held for posting 'objectionable content’ on FB

February 05, 2013 07:26 pm | Updated December 04, 2021 11:40 pm IST - Agra

A government official was arrested on Tuesday for allegedly posting ‘objectionable content’ about Samajwadi Party chief Mulayam Singh Yadav and Union Minister Kapil Sibal on social networking website Facebook.

Sanjay Chaudhari, a civil engineer with the State government, was booked under IT Act in Agra for uploading derogatory cartoons and posting objectionable comments on the two leaders, SSP Agra, SC Dubey said.

A case under relevant sections of IPC has also been registered against Mr. Chaudhari for trying to disturb communal harmony by making undesirable comments against a particular community, police said.

The engineer, who also runs an NGO, has pleaded innocence claiming that some unscrupulous elements uploaded the content after hacking his Facebook account.

In November last year, two Mumbai girls were arrested for allegedly writing objectionable comments relating to late Shiv Sena leader Bal Thackeray.

The arrests had sparked nation-wide anger among the civil society activists who had accused the administrations of misusing the IT Act.
